140W PD 3.1 Output vs Real Laptop Charging Speeds
The 140W spec is honest. With the included USB-C cable and a MacBook Pro 14 supporting PD 3.1, the 737 negotiated the full 140W during the first 30 minutes of charging. Most competing banks top out at 100W per port, and that gap matters when you are trying to push a large battery from empty to useful in under an hour.
For laptops without PD 3.1 support, the bank falls back to standard 100W PD 3.0, which is still faster than nearly every wall charger that ships in a laptop box. I tested this on a Dell XPS 13 and a Lenovo ThinkPad X1 Carbon, and both negotiated the maximum 100W their systems would accept. 165W Total Across Three USB-C Ports
The total output is 165W shared across three USB-C ports, with 100W maximum on a single port. I confirmed this by plugging a MacBook Pro into USB-C1 and a Dell XPS into USB-C2 at the same time. The bank allocated 100W to the MacBook and dropped the XPS to around 60W, which is exactly the kind of smart power distribution I want when both laptops are low.
For comparison, the Anker 737 has 140W total versus 165W here, and the extra 25W matters if you regularly charge two laptops at once. For single-device charging, the difference is negligible. The 165W model pulls ahead only when you push the third port hard.

25,000mAh Real-World Capacity and Pass-Through
I drained this bank from 100% to auto-shutoff twice during testing. The first cycle delivered 87.4Wh to a MacBook Pro 14 before shutting down, and the second delivered 84.1Wh. That puts real-world capacity at about 88% of the rated 90Wh, which is well above average for the category.
Pass-through charging worked without issues, meaning I could charge the bank from a wall outlet while the USB-C ports powered my laptop. This is a quieter feature than 140W output, but it matters during hotel nights when there is only one wall outlet near the desk.

200W Total Output and Dual USB-C Split
The total output is 200W, split as 140W on USB-C1 and 100W on USB-C2 when both ports are in use. In real-world testing, that translated to 100W on the MacBook Pro and 65W on the Dell XPS at the same time, with the remaining 35W distributed to a third USB-A device.
This split is enough to charge two laptops simultaneously at a useful rate, which is a use case the lower-wattage banks cannot match. For users who travel with two laptops (a personal MacBook and a work ThinkPad, for example), the Nexode replaces two separate chargers.

Capacity in mAh vs Watt-Hours – What Actually Matters
Most power banks advertise capacity in mAh (milliamp-hours), but the number that matters for laptops is watt-hours (Wh). Watt-hours account for the actual energy stored, factoring in voltage. Two banks can both claim 20,000mAh and one can have 30% more usable energy depending on the cell voltage.
To convert mAh to Wh for laptops, multiply mAh by 3.7V (the nominal voltage of lithium-ion cells) and divide by 1,000. A 20,000mAh bank has roughly 74Wh. A 25,000mAh bank has roughly 92.5Wh. A 26,250mAh bank has roughly 97Wh. That is the number you compare against your laptop’s battery.
For a 14-inch MacBook Pro with a 70Wh battery, you want at least a 25,000mAh bank to get one full charge plus some reserve. For a Dell XPS 13 with a 51Wh battery, a 20,000mAh bank will deliver nearly two full charges.
Wattage Requirements by Laptop Type
Different laptops draw different wattages, and matching the bank’s output to your laptop matters more than raw capacity. Here is the quick reference I built during testing:
- MacBook Air M3 / Dell XPS 13 / Lenovo ThinkPad X1 Carbon: 45W is enough, 65W is comfortable
- MacBook Pro 14 / Dell XPS 15 / Lenovo Legion: 100W minimum for fast charging, 140W ideal
- MacBook Pro 16 / Razer Blade 16 / Mobile workstations: 140W minimum, 230W+ for sustained load
- Chromebook / iPad Pro / Steam Deck: 45W is plenty, 65W is overkill in a good way
Forum users on r/laptops consistently recommend at least 65W for standard ultrabooks and 100W+ for any 14-inch or larger laptop. Going below your laptop’s required wattage means the bank will charge slowly when the laptop is under load, or not at all during heavy workloads.
USB-C Power Delivery, PD 3.1, and PPS Explained
USB-C Power Delivery (PD) is the protocol that lets a power bank and a laptop negotiate the fastest safe charging rate. PD 3.0 supports up to 100W, and PD 3.1 (also called Extended Power Range) supports up to 240W. Most modern laptops support at least PD 3.0.
PPS (Programmable Power Supply) is a refinement of PD 3.0 that allows finer voltage and current adjustments. Samsung Galaxy phones benefit most from PPS, drawing up to 45W instead of the 25W they would get from standard PD. If you own a Samsung device, look for PPS support.
Quick Charge (QC) is Qualcomm’s competing protocol, mostly used by Android phones. Most modern banks support both PD and QC, so compatibility is rarely an issue. The key spec to check is the maximum wattage on the USB-C port you plan to use.
Airline Carry-On Rules: The 100Wh Battery Limit
The FAA, EU aviation authorities, and most international carriers cap power banks at 100Wh for carry-on luggage without airline approval. Banks between 100Wh and 160Wh require airline approval, and banks over 160Wh are banned from passenger aircraft entirely.
Every bank in this guide sits below the 100Wh limit, so they all fly without any extra paperwork. The Anker Prime at 99.75Wh is the largest capacity you can carry. Check your specific airline’s policy before flying internationally, as some carriers enforce stricter rules.
Always carry power banks in your cabin bag, never in checked luggage. The FAA and IATA both prohibit power banks in checked bags due to fire risk. The 100Wh rule is universal, but always check your carrier’s specific policy.
Built-In Cables vs Separate Cables
Built-in cables are more convenient for travel, but they lock you into a fixed connector type. The Anker 25,000mAh 165W and the Anker 20,000mAh with built-in cable are the strongest picks if you prioritize convenience.
Separate cables give you more flexibility. If you switch between USB-C laptops, MagSafe iPhones, and Micro-USB accessories, separate cables let you adapt. Most users today only need USB-C, so the built-in cable trade-off is more about convenience than flexibility.
Forum users on r/EDC appreciate retractable cables for the cable management but warn that cheaper retractable mechanisms can fail after 12-18 months. Anker’s retractable cables have the longest track record in this guide.
Weight, Smart Displays, and Portability Trade-Offs
Weight scales with capacity. The lightest 20K bank in this guide is the INIU at 13.4 ounces, and the heaviest 26K bank is the Anker Prime at 600g. For daily commute carry, anything under 1 pound feels reasonable. For air travel, anything under 1.5 pounds is acceptable.
Smart displays are genuinely useful. They show real-time wattage, which helps you understand charging behavior. The downside is battery drain in standby and reduced readability in direct sunlight. LED indicator dots are simpler and longer-lasting, but they do not give you the same level of detail.
For users who prioritize portability above all else, the INIU and the Anker 20,000mAh are the strongest picks. For users who want maximum power regardless of weight, the Anker Prime is the clear winner.
